#3d53cf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3d53cf is composed of 23.9% red, 32.5%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.5% cyan, 59.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 231 degrees, a saturation of 60.3% and a lightness of 52.5%. #3d53cf color hex could be obtained by blending #7aa6ff with #00009f.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#3d53cf
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03040a is the darkest color, while #fafafe is the lightest one.
